Robert
Zernicke
Dec 21, 1945 — Nov 27, 2025
Robert H. Zernicke, 79, of Pulaski, passed away peacefully on Thursday, November 27, 2025, at St. Mary's Hospital in Green Bay. The son of Howard and Phyllis (Specht) Zernicke was born in Shawano on December 21, 1945.
Bob grew up on the family farm in the town of Lessor and was a 1964 graduate of Bonduel High School. He married Wanda Doxtator at Calvary Lutheran church in 1977. Bob worked for Fort Howard Paper Company for 35 years. After his retirement from Fort Howard, he drove bus for Zernicke Bus in Pulaski for several years. Bob and Wanda were part-time custodians for 11 years at Calvary Lutheran Church in Green Bay, where he was a longtime member.
In his younger years, Bob enjoyed playing baseball, bowling, and deer hunting in Lessor with his stepson and brother-in-law. He loved playing cards with family and watching old westerns. Bob was a handyman and was always willing to lend a hand to anyone who needed it.
